Remember Dooly's pool hall? It's the new home of GroupHEALTH Benefit Solutions

Company grows into larger Barrie office

Matt Houghton's company had been on the hunt for a bigger space in Barrie for two years when he received an email about a pool hall with 'Barney purple' ceilings.

The former Barrie resident and CEO of GroupHEALTH Benefit Solutions instantly recognized the space as the former Dooly's Pool Hall on Bryne Drve. 

Houghton grew up in Oshawa, moved to the U.S. and then came to Barrie when he was 26.

"I actually played pool here a couple of times," said Houghton. "I had difficulty grasping the vision of converting a retail space into an office. We couldn't be happier to have this new facility in Barrie."

The vision officially became a reality Thursday when Houghton and Mayor Jeff Lehman cut the ribbon on the bright, 11,200 square feet facility that is GroupHealth's expanded office after growing in the city for a decade.

"Why Barrie? I still view Barrie as home. It's a place where I spent ten years and I think it's an amazing city.  When I came back from the states I could really live anywhere in or outside the GTA. It's just an amazing spot. You rarely can find a place where you've got forests and nature, a lake you can actually swim in without glowing in the dark and a great cost of living. It's the perfect spot for us to expand," Houghton said. 

The company now employs 51 people in Barrie and is hiring.

There are currently eight positions available at the Barrie office including Director of Group Benefits Underwriting, Inside Sales Representatives, and Part-Time Human Resources Generalist.

"You need new space all the time and it's a good problem to have," said Mayor Lehman, who told a crowd of employees he was also a former patron of Dooly's. 

"Its amazing to see a pool hall converted this kind of collaborative open office environment. The pace of the growth has been remarkable. Our economy is firing on all cylinders. You're in a city itself that is going to grow as a market."

GroupHealth was named as one of Canada’s Top Small & Medium Employers for 2017 by Mediacorp Canada Inc.

The company says it earned the award by providing a 'best-in-class employee experience' which includes competitive compensation and extensive health and wellness benefits to a “Happy Friday” program that gives employees every second Friday off.  Key employee perks include an employee lounge with televisions, subsidies for courses and programs of up to $2,000 annually per employee to encourage professional development, and a comprehensive performance recognition program that includes individual peer-to-peer recognition and on-the-spot awards.

"We always knew we wanted to stay here. We had a great core of people. In Barrie there's probably a disproportionate amount of great people that would love to work where they live instead of doing that killer commute," said Houghton.
